One of the most popular dishes in Sudanese cuisine is "ful medames," a hearty and nutritious stew made from fava beans cooked with garlic, onions, and spices. This dish is typically served for breakfast and is often accompanied by bread or other starches. Another staple in Sudanese cuisine is "kisra," a thin flatbread made from sorghum or millet flour. This bread is perfect for scooping up stews and sauces. In addition to these traditional dishes, Sudanese cuisine also features a variety of meat-based dishes, such as "asida" (a porridge-like dish made from wheat flour and eaten with a spicy meat stew) and "shayyah" (grilled meat skewers marinated in a flavorful blend of spices). Sudanese cuisine is known for its bold flavors and use of aromatic spices such as cumin, coriander, and ginger. These spices add depth and complexity to dishes, creating a truly memorable dining experience. In Cairo, the capital city of Egypt, Sudanese cuisine can also be found due to the large Sudanese community living there. Many restaurants and eateries in Cairo serve authentic Sudanese dishes, allowing locals and tourists alike to experience the flavors of Sudan without leaving the city.
